2013 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port Specs, Features & Options
Here's everything you need to know about each trim in the 2013 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port lineup. Compare pricing, specs, key features and more.
1 of 3 ![]() Outlander Sport ES Sport Utility 4D | 2 of 3 ![]() Outlander Sport SE Sport Utility 4D | 3 of 3 ![]() Outlander Sport LE Sport Utility 4D | |||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Fair Market Price | $5,819 | $6,196 | $7,085 | ||
Fuel Economy | City 24/Hwy 31/Comb 27 MPG | City 24/Hwy 29/Comb 26 MPG | City 24/Hwy 29/Comb 26 MPG | ||
Fuel Type | Gas | Gas | Gas | ||
Horsepower | 148 @ 6000 RPM | 148 @ 6000 RPM | 148 @ 6000 RPM | ||
Seating | 5 | 5 | 5 | ||
Cargo Volume | 49.50 cu ft | 49.50 cu ft | 49.50 cu ft | ||
Dimensions | 169.1" L x 69.7" W x 64.2" H | 169.1" L x 69.7" W x 64.2" H | 169.1" L x 69.7" W x 64.2" H | ||
Engine | 4-Cyl, 2.0 Liter | 4-Cyl, 2.0 Liter | 4-Cyl, 2.0 Liter | ||
Configurations | Inline | Inline | Inline |

Curb Weight | 3087 pounds | 3263 pounds | Not Available | ||
EPA Total Interior | 119.2 cubic feet | 119.2 cubic feet | 119.2 cubic feet | ||
Fuel Capacity | 16.6 gallons | 15.8 gallons | 15.8 gallons | ||
Front Head Room | 39.4 inches | 39.4 inches | 39.4 inches | ||
Front Leg Room | 41.6 inches | 41.6 inches | 41.6 inches | ||
Minimum Ground Clearance | 8.5 inches | 8.5 inches | 8.5 inches | ||
Overall Length | 169.1 inches | 169.1 inches | 169.1 inches | ||
Front Shoulder Room | 56.2 inches | 56.2 inches | 56.2 inches | ||
Turning Diameter | 34.8 feet | 34.8 feet | 34.8 feet | ||
Wheel Base | 105.1 inches | 105.1 inches | 105.1 inches | ||
Width with mirrors | 69.7 inches | 69.7 inches | 69.7 inches |
